The sunrays were dying in the horizon, night will come soon. Cain doesn’t want to listen to mom when she told him not to play in the woods, but there he was, running as fast as his small legs could let him, the fear was bringing his heart out of his chest, looking backwards, the only thing that he could see was his chaser, a really tall monster, a dinosaur-like look with two bat wings, and its head had no skin, it was just the skull with flesh attached to it, Cain can´t focus to use magic , but as mom had said once, he was too little to be powerful. Finally, the street lights appeared at the end of the hill, the sky was already dyed in dark blue, while the moon and stars appeared slowly, a great relief for little Cain, he was running faster, but his chaser was even faster, but there was a huge tree trunk blocking his path ahead, too big to jump It over. Cain felt that it was his end, while he ran more and more nearer to the tree trunk, he began to cry, I don´t want to die! He shouted so hard that his shout was heard over the strong roars of the monster. Cain finally reached the tree trunk and stopped, he turned backwards really slowly, he attempted to cast a ray, but no, it doesn´t work. In a moment he will be dead; he closed his eyes and started praying. Suddenly, from the branches, a silhouette jumped taking him with strength, throwing him towards the other side of the trunk; but those arms that took him were subtle arms, as if they were feminine arms, Cain shut his eyes really hard, while he fell on the grass, he wasn´t hurt, then he heard a strong roar, but a roar of pain, followed by an earth shake. Cain opened his eyes and climbed up the trunk and watched his rescuer holding a sword just used to kill the creature.

 
            – “Are you ok?” Said the lady without looking at him

            -”Yeah, I think!” Said Cain.

            -”So go home…” Added the lady.

The mysterious woman went away immediately, disappearing between the branches in the same as she had arrived.

Cain felt strange, but he took the lady´s advice and went straight home.  He left the woods and he will not play alone ever again.

Cain walked slowly and calmly to his house, when he was walking down the slope, he found the city in normal conditions as always and that made him feel safe.

A few days ago he was afraid of monsters getting into the city.  While he walked, strangely, the sky was turning darker, even though it was night, he stared at the sky, and there it was, flying over the city, the academy of Darhan; it was like an eclipse that blocked the moon’s glow, a wonder of engineering, hundreds of tons flying; he was looking amazed by this thing flying over the city; then three robots with wings and rockets like in the films, left the academy, the robots flew towards the forest; Cain remained astonished by the spectacular thing the academy was. He wanted to study in one but his mom didn’t allow him to do so.

            – “This world is already screwed up, and you want to fight wars? Come on Cain, you don´t have to be a soldier! There are too many already!”

That’s what mom always says, but he doesn’t care, he still wanted to be a great soldier; to work in secret operations, to defend weak towns, to fight against monsters, and to make this a better world. But no, mother wanted him to be a lawyer, a doctor or a businessman, adults’ life is very boring, he always said to himself…
